Columnist Peter Benton: Crowd support key in keeping Takefuji Classic

The Las Vegas Country Club will be the setting Thursday for the first round of the LPGA's Takefuji Classic, where, with the exceptions of Annika Sorenstam, Se Ri Pak and Grace Park, everyone who is anyone on tour will be competing.
Last year's champion, Cristie Kerr, will be back attempting to defend her title, and also looking to repeat as champion is Candie Kung, winner of the inaugural Takefuji Classic.
Australia's Karrie Webb, playing so much better than she has for the past couple of years, will no doubt also be in the hunt, as could Laura Davies.
Davies, a crowd favorite, will make her initial start in this event, and along with a myriad of other admirers I cannot wait to see her perform.
The appearance of this incredibly affable player is a terrific plus for the Takefuji, and with her laid-back personality, coupled with her go-for-broke attitude, you can guarantee she will have a tremendous gallery.
There is not yet word of the contract being renewed for this tournament for next season, though a strong show of crowd support would go a long way toward making that happen.
Admission is $15 daily, a ground pass (good for three days) is $30, and a clubhouse badge is $50.
Because of limited parking, the Gold Lot at the Convention Center on Paradise will be used, with a free shuttle bus transporting patrons to and from the course.
